College Football Week 5 Same Game Parlays Picks & Predictions: Michigan vs. Iowa
Michigan vs. Iowa
- Leg 1: Michigan -10.5 (-114)
- Leg 2: JJ McCarthy Under 205.5 passing yards (-114)
- Leg 3: Spencer Petras Under 140.5 passing yards (-114)
- Leg 4: Blake Corum Over 80.5 rushing yards (-114)
Iowa had this game marked on the calendar since December when Michigan thrashed them 42-3 in the Big Ten championship. The Hawkeyesâ offense was pitiful last year, especially at quarterback, finishing in the bottom 30 in passing yards per game. Nothing has changed with Spencer Petras throwing for 524 yards, one touchdown, two picks, and a 51.1 completion percentage this season.
They play defense well, as their 5.75 points allowed per game leads the country, and they have nine starters on the 2022 Preseason All-Big Ten team. Weâll see a Michigan offense that has been able to throw up points all season find themselves struggling to move the ball. Quarterback J.J. McCarthy has been solid as the starter, but Blake Corum has been the star with 314 yards in seven touchdowns in his last two games. It will also help the Wolverines to have a veteran and talented offensive line in the trenches.
The Michigan defense has been pretty good and held Maryland to their lowest points this season. If Iowa had any resemblance of an offense, you could give them a chance to win or at least cover, but you canât trust them to stay in contention.
